      Role Summary
 Global Safety Medical Director - Hematology/Oncology. Lead safety strategy and staff in Global Patient Safety, ensuring full regulatory compliance for the Hematology-Oncology portfolio.
 
 Responsibilities
 
 - Validate safety signals and lead safety signal assessments
 
 - Develop and maintain Core Safety Information
 
 - Prepare/review core and regional risk management plans including additional risk minimization measures
 
 - Prepare/review safety sections of periodic aggregate reports
 
 - Provide safety input to protocols, statistical analysis plans, and clinical study reports
 
 - Prepare/review safety sections of new drug applications and other regulatory filings
 
 - Serve as safety expert on Evidence Generation Team for assigned products
 
 - Inspection Readiness
